At an installation service for Bishop Marvin Sapp as Senior Pastor of The Chosen Vessel Cathedral, Bryant says that Jesus was ‘wrong’ and out of order for the vast majaority of his life.

Jesus accepted his call to ministry at 30. He had been in carpentry since he was 13. He ran the family business since he was 17. At the risk of being heretical tonight, might I suggest to you that 85 percent of Jesus’s life he was out of order. 85 percent of his life he was doing what he was not called to do. God y’all done got quiet.

For 85 percent of his life he was not flowing in his God-given function. 85 percent of his life he is doing what his natural father wanted, but it did not line up with his divine DNA.

85 percent of his life and he’s anointed, he’s called, he’s chosen and he’s wrong.
